如何在社交聊天系统中实现个性化推荐?
随着互联网技术的飞速发展,社交聊天系统已成为人们日常生活中不可或缺的一部分。如何在社交聊天系统中实现个性化推荐,成为了一个备受关注的话题。本文将从以下几个方面探讨如何在社交聊天系统中实现个性化推荐。
一、了解用户需求
1. 用户画像:通过分析用户的年龄、性别、兴趣爱好、地理位置等信息,构建用户画像,为个性化推荐提供基础。
2. 用户行为分析:通过用户在社交聊天系统中的浏览、搜索、互动等行为,挖掘用户兴趣和需求。
二、推荐算法
1. 协同过滤:基于用户行为和兴趣,通过相似度计算,为用户推荐相似的用户或内容。
2. 内容推荐:根据用户兴趣,为用户推荐相关的内容,如文章、图片、视频等。
3. 深度学习:利用深度学习技术,对用户行为和内容进行建模,实现更精准的个性化推荐。
三、推荐效果优化
1. 实时反馈:根据用户对推荐内容的反馈,调整推荐算法,提高推荐效果。
2. A/B测试:通过对比不同推荐策略的效果,优化推荐算法。
3. 个性化调整:根据用户反馈,调整推荐内容,满足用户个性化需求。
案例分析:
以某知名社交聊天平台为例,该平台通过分析用户行为和兴趣,为用户推荐相关话题、好友和内容。在推荐算法方面,该平台采用协同过滤和内容推荐相结合的方式,提高推荐效果。同时,通过实时反馈和A/B测试,不断优化推荐算法,满足用户个性化需求。
总结:
在社交聊天系统中实现个性化推荐,需要了解用户需求、运用推荐算法和优化推荐效果。通过不断优化和调整,可以为用户提供更加精准、个性化的推荐,提升用户体验。
猜你喜欢:跨境网络解决方案设计